Received: by 2002:a05:6a10:2726:0:0:0:0 with SMTP id ib38csp1943056pxb; Fri, 25 Mar 2022 08:21:16 -0700 (PDT) X-Google-Smtp-Source: ABdhPJzpjzRBKiCrvGblwcNP+gyAAFiFqPtxIID9jUZuuonva95iBhepnMjd8nMHpGCWPSqQh9aU X-Received: by 2002:a05:6402:11cc:b0:418:d64d:ccdf with SMTP id j12-20020a05640211cc00b00418d64dccdfmr13642142edw.139.1648221675858; Fri, 25 Mar 2022 08:21:15 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1648221675; cv=none; d=google.com; s=arc-20160816; b=RwlHaGi1hZUDnYXFcUPjXTiXZ6lf0jTlzjemRjct5uHMgg6HS7CP9I/EwQ2+H1JF/R eLPgeWK+68BQkmI9CiiIjV8YoUgwyobS6Bvf2VSqjf1rEUuXfXg8rqnq33/+xTCaHHcx 1EPoEkfZUp9oKUtWKZHb1tknJq6Q8ajwLu3q5zdPGFxW3fPnrMP+nXYjU2Mg8XYGkJE8 yNlVRo4Wvf7tjYKiJrUwBozNSP7FxKuLKvRBQMXoUB1KF15iWUbPc9tqOpc+U7O3zy4z ND2VzM+3+EFf9TTNG9FhVs2qoo2Q+FFRWZZr+z2kvofp0LVAPqPXWnqNs6BOmVtPwJzR 8sIw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:cc:to:subject:message-id:date:from:in-reply-to :references:mime-version:dkim-signature; bh=tK9niD9zkQNKvxp511CYkJeHeDOwwCyGPfpIMRzpbn8=; b=YWueVWLWTR9TAdeHsyml7o9yvfcCgnlZN7InidQPGSAf/nLz2mPPjMNO8C2c85ZXmk v4uJOhg/tuzLmSu8i6Ux95MWav+uBXIAXu7YENVeFQAD9qUSt8L/E5ZMxpjGfoEXyA/q nbnvdpsJ6jBsjCPsFVbMISQqm3ZNzGIpbND0l2HbJxLltHJjloQjG4lTAjuPov9QJLVS w4A4+W+mB2jmzCkXfT/wTuNElghkIzj/c4C+rV1MnCLvf8SE1YRFAd7EiCwUR+CKnrxj +lRvG9HyGaAXSS39esFC3H2eDzy5dgkkxLkze4/AFLyAiguyhp2cqIBSr6eTNlGYXkax tz0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@soleen.com header.s=google header.b=ILnVSpcv;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id v1-20020a17090690c100b006df76385db0si1445109ejw.592.2022.03.25.08.20.41; Fri, 25 Mar 2022 08:21:15 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@soleen.com header.s=google header.b=ILnVSpcv;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S240379AbiCWSh1 (ORCPT + 99 others); Wed, 23 Mar 2022 14:37:27 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:40092 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1344096AbiCWShV (ORCPT ); Wed, 23 Mar 2022 14:37:21 -0400 Received: from mail-ej1-x634.google.com (mail-ej1-x634.google.com [IPv6:2a00:1450:4864:20::634]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id AC75B8933B for ; Wed, 23 Mar 2022 11:35:40 -0700 (PDT) Received: by mail-ej1-x634.google.com with SMTP id o10so4660690ejd.1 for ; Wed, 23 Mar 2022 11:35:40 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=soleen.com;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=tK9niD9zkQNKvxp511CYkJeHeDOwwCyGPfpIMRzpbn8=; b=ILnVSpcvcMvyYeY4ROSboPGgS/ta0E1CBAGTw7IUPxpVOCKagtB2L6w4QyfvColzts lKoTTSAc3A59SaIQTrXgzUbBbPhDY+NCo+0THzukfmHGxObAO+MTE33aiSbzLaylxIR5 vu3hdy/bc4BJMa2tF3nPWOM9mpVJRd5WMaZWC3ZxPK7t7PJ+kUHzdIPzkXeIYmbpy4iE WPKmOMjscxczUZmAkqdVQZvSP+uk9oWRXLbENpPVazMvVKH4AnAipdRqWqKxBI1AJP0c Hmsm2+SzQmRxOwEJr544YYtaT9z5K1U6741acmsivUDCh/MrQtFM6M+3sq7CDOm8e1vj gsdg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=tK9niD9zkQNKvxp511CYkJeHeDOwwCyGPfpIMRzpbn8=; b=T2phTJO8RatG3IKtsSgPCdychcnvjAix6DHLt7/VDDUekF4w8ChJZEoG/m4UArg6R4 jNvh/4sUfDWchvoLHftDfRvozXNqXOVb9krlGFPCzwdWnJPkKvBasjxlMDk3wBmBD1qX LpKp+AiEXGZPBwhlCuHwP+SldkADb03Q3mU4bYqsmBOK81NaL1BoiuqOoPIORULeh7OY iLtoHGL1L/bQ+C/KwdzG5GJsEG2/RBsP9u676qsVewxgemWHO3oquirUFTax+GE94c5I hYVKDnwYBYxozx54tjGzedlqQpQhB2CqHIdoi0klI8S/P5x0R4l3qGA5TADBp7LLP7MG lAHg== X-Gm-Message-State: AOAM532XRtF7NOgOSCM/6nOCAN2N0TYoLESP7p4V8+suRVAJ1YqsMesG R4vCfn7MVrtJ8VYMt+Uqa8x3OiaucFEtUR6PKxDFtw== X-Received: by 2002:a17:907:1c96:b0:6db:57e5:3e2f with SMTP id nb22-20020a1709071c9600b006db57e53e2fmr1506594ejc.705.1648060539244; Wed, 23 Mar 2022 11:35:39 -0700 (PDT) MIME-Version: 1.0 References: <20220322144447.3563146-1-tongtiangen@huawei.com> <20220322144447.3563146-4-tongtiangen@huawei.com> In-Reply-To: <20220322144447.3563146-4-tongtiangen@huawei.com> From: Pasha Tatashin Date: Wed, 23 Mar 2022 14:35:02 -0400 Message-ID: Subject: Re: [PATCH -next v2 3/4] arm64: mm: add support for page table check To: Tong Tiangen Cc: Thomas Gleixner , Ingo Molnar , Borislav Petkov , Dave Hansen , "maintainer:X86 ARCHITECTURE (32-BIT AND 64-BIT)" , "H. Peter Anvin" , Andrew Morton , Catalin Marinas , Will Deacon , Paul Walmsley , Palmer Dabbelt , Albert Ou , LKML , linux-mm , Linux ARM , linux-riscv@lists.infradead.org Content-Type: text/plain; charset="UTF-8" X-Spam-Status: No, score=-2.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,RCVD_IN_DNSWL_NONE, SPF_HELO_NONE,S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Mar 22, 2022 at 10:25 AM Tong Tiangen wrote: > > From: Kefeng Wang > > As commit d283d422c6c4 ("x86: mm: add x86_64 support for page table > check"), add some necessary page table check hooks into routines that > modify user page tables. > > Signed-off-by: Kefeng Wang > Signed-off-by: Tong Tiangen Reviewed-by: Pasha Tatashin